Transaction 3cdf37ef13036500df2f5c51fba94e79b65e26f26536fefd159ac879ad321cbf

5 Input
2 Outputs
  • 3cdf37ef13036500df2f5c51fba94e79b65e26f26536fefd159ac879ad321cbf:0
  • value  2500000
    address  1Gaq5yzFKy65kqgztWkiHHky5e9rk2hyBr
  • 3cdf37ef13036500df2f5c51fba94e79b65e26f26536fefd159ac879ad321cbf:1
  • value  333866
    address  3QDiyzLdBPmVsUuTDEcLDrNVGJeCcG8yTi